UNION PRINTING COMPANY. William Steuck established Union Printing Company in 1894. Originally located at 135 West 5th Street, in 1927 Union Printing Company relocated across the street into a two-story building at 158 West 5th Street. In 1937, Allan SIGMAN took over the business from his father-in-law.

In 1968, UNION-HOERMANN PRESS was created.

The 1899-1900 Dubuque City Directory listed 158 5th.

The 1909 through the 1918 Dubuque City Directory gave this business address as 158-164 5th.

The 1922 Dubuque Telephone Directory listed 220 W. 5th.

The 1923 Dubuque City Directory through the 1937 Dubuque Consurvey Directory listed 210 W. 5th.

The 1939 through 1966 Dubuque City Directory listed 456 Main.
